Flenaugh interviewed Dave Cole, a math enthusiast since third grade, who shared his journey from loving math puzzles to a career in engineering and computer science. He emphasized the importance of making math fun and engaging for children. Cole discussed his summer math camp for elementary school kids. He also highlighted the series of math-themed mystery books that he authored for kids. Cole advised parents to incorporate math into everyday activities and to use puzzles and games to make learning enjoyable.Here is a list of games shared in the episode:- Supply and Demand Game (a tag-style outdoor game simulating food chains and resource management)- Mobius Strip Activity (cutting and exploring properties of Mobius strips)- Digital Clock Equation Game (making equations from the numbers on a digital clock)- Sudoku Puzzles- Equations (a strategy math game where you start with the solution and find ways to reach it)- 24 (a card game where you use four numbers to make 24 with basic operations)- Set (a pattern recognition card game)- "Dave" Math Card Game (a custom game similar to War, using addition, subtraction, and multiplication based on card color)Support the showWe drop new episodes every Saturday at 5 p.m. Pacific Time.
